菕`Boot-Preloader T8032 NO ack!
DRAM Channel A Calibration.
HW Byte 0 : DQS(11 ~ 30), Size 20, Set 20.
HW Byte 1 : DQS(7 ~ 29), Size 23, Set 18.
HW Byte 2 : DQS(5 ~ 31), Size 27, Set 18.
HW Byte 3 : DQS(2 ~ 29), Size 28, Set 15.
DRAM A Size = 256 Mbytes.
DRAM Channel B Calibration.
HW Byte 4 : DQS(13 ~ 34), Size 22, Set 23.
HW Byte 5 : DQS(7 ~ 27), Size 21, Set 17.
DRAM B Size = 128 Mbytes.
Boot
Start Pmain
0x00003198
NID=0x1d00f1ad
LZHS addr:0x00100040
LZHS size:0x0005f578
LZHS checksum:0x000000cd
Boot
Start Lmain
MT5395 Boot Loader v0.9
MUSB none SoftReset 0x29424 = 0x01030000.
MUSB pBase = 0xF0029000 init ok.
MUSB none SoftReset 0x29424 = 0x01030000.
MUSB pBase = 0xF002E000 init ok.
Boot reason: A/C power on!!-------------use external edid, disable internal edid------------------
SIF_Master0: new design
SIF_Master1: old design
Boot reason: A/C power on!!T8032 init A/C on case loader stage...
Load T8032 FW (addr: 0x d34d38, size: 24576)success!!
T8032 FW version: 67
T8032 change to loader stage...
LDR_FlashCopy 0xf010 0x2ca80 0x80
Detect NAND flash ID: 0x1D00F1AD
Detect HY27U1G8F2BTR NAND flash(SLC): 128MB
NAND_BDM_Mount: Partid=0, offset=0x0, size=0x100000
[BDM] Partition: 0, Bad Block Count: 0
Do USB upgrade
No USB device.
USB upgrade stop
Boot reason: A/C power on!!Boot reason: A/C power on!!Org:0x34 Flags:0x34
Boot reason: A/C power on!!Enable Led blinking (gpio_idx 3, on_value 1, period 15, type: OPCTRL)
NAND load lzhs header from 0x40000 to dram(0xfe6030), size=2048
Decompression uboot to 0x00f00000...
NAND load image from 0x40000 to dram(0xfe6030), size=0x34109
LZHS hardware decode start
LZHS hardware decode done
Starting image...
U-Boot starts...
NAND Flash: Detect NAND flash ID: 0x1D00F1AD
Detect HY27U1G8F2BTR NAND flash: 128MB
128 MiB
Booting sequence is from NAND Flash
In: serial
Out: serial
Err: serial
SIF_Master0: new design
SIF_Master1: old design
Boot from kernelA and rootfs at partition 6
Hit any key to stop autoboot: 0
Partition rootfsA defined at mtdparts:
ID:6, Offset:0x00800000, Size:0x00500000
Loading from nand0, offset 0x400000
Automatic boot of image at addr 0x00008000 ...
## Booting kernel from Legacy Image at 00008000 ...
XIP Kernel Image ... OK
OK
Starting kernel ...
Uncompressing Linux..................................................................................... done, booting the kernel.
INIT: version 2.86 booting
Mounting local filesystems: mount mount: according to /proc/mounts, /dev/root is already mounted on /
Running rc.local...
net.ipv4.tcp_window_scaling = 6
# mount basic
UBI device number 0, total 200 LEBs (25395200 bytes, 24.2 MiB), available 0 LEBs (0 bytes), LEB size 126976 bytes (124.0 KiB)
real 0m 0.07s
user 0m 0.00s
sys 0m 0.05s
real 0m 0.03s
user 0m 0.00s
sys 0m 0.02s
[AppManager]init
[AppManager]init dfb start
[AppManager]init dfb
input thread's parent pid is 294 tid is 294
[DirectFB]: Wait to Init IR...!
[ProcessManager]init
[ProcessManager]init
[AM] init succeed
[AM] default process state '4' 'dtv_app_mtk'
Unhandled fault: external abort on linefetch (0x1806) at 0x00000000
Internal error: : 1806 [#1] PREEMPT
Modules linked in: star_mac ioctl_reg_func fusion
CPU: 0 Not tainted (2.6.27 #1)
PC is at vIO32Write1BMsk+0x30/0x44 [ioctl_reg_func]
LR is at x_os_drv_crit_start+0x10/0x14 [ioctl_reg_func]
pc : [<bf075cf0>] lr : [<bf376cd0>] psr: 60000093
sp : c53bfc60 ip : c53bfc50 fp : c53bfc7c
r10: bf04c84c r9 : bf04f0d4 r8 : c538008c
r7 : 00000008 r6 : 00000000 r5 : 00000004 r4 : f0035280
r3 : 00248000 r2 : 00000004 r1 : 00000000 r0 : 60000013
Flags: nZCv IRQs off FIQs on Mode SVC_32 ISA ARM Segment user
Control: 00c5387d Table: 05138008 DAC: 00000015
Process init_thread (pid: 307, stack limit = 0xc53be260)
Stack: (0xc53bfc60 to 0xc53c0000)
fc60: bf56eccc bf59eed0 00000000 00000028 c53bfca4 c53bfc80 bf0b974c bf075ccc
fc80: bf56eccc 00000000 bf58d468 00000028 c538008c bf04c84c c53bfcbc c53bfca8
fca0: bf0baca8 bf0b9710 bf5a1a6c 00000000 c53bfcd4 c53bfcc0 bf09cc94 bf0bac38
fcc0: bf58d468 00000028 c53bfd04 c53bfcd8 bf0eb294 bf09cc88 bf04f248 bf379a78
fce0: bf04f590 00000000 00000000 00000000 00000000 00000000 c53bfd84 c53bfd08
fd00: bf04f2ac bf0eb23c bf060c08 bf02dd6c 00000000 c53bfd38 00000000 00000000
fd20: 00000087 00000000 00410008 00000087 c53bfd00 c53bfd40 00000000 00000000
fd40: bf060a4c bf060924 00000000 00000001 c53bfd84 c53bfd60 bf060cd4 c53bfe78
fd60: 00000000 c53bfdb0 00000028 c538008c 00410001 000045ec c53bfdd4 c53bfd88
fd80: bf057c90 bf04f26c bf0583f4 00000000 00000000 c53bfda0 c00655dc c006533c
fda0: 00000044 00000039 00000001 0001079e 0001070d 00000000 bf58f718 00410002
fdc0: bf58f718 00000028 c53bff1c c53bfdd8 bf06a098 bf057a00 c53bfe1c c53bfde8
fde0: c0063e84 c00636a8 c53bfe64 c538466c c53800b4 c53bfe78 c02916cc 20000013
fe00: 00000000 000200d0 c02916f0 00000001 c53bfe74 c53bfe20 c0065644 c0063e70
fe20: 00000044 00000010 00000000 00000000 00000000 c0291e8c 00000000 00000000
fe40: fffffffe 00000000 c53bfe7c c53bfe58 c004f600 c00289e4 c53be000 c65470c0
fe60: 00000015 c65496e0 c654721c c0282c78 c53bfe9c c53bfe80 00000000 c538008c
fe80: 00000030 00000000 00000000 c65470c0 c53bfeb4 c53bfea0 c004fc6c c004fbf8
fea0: c65470c0 c53be000 c53bfefc c53bfeb8 c01f43d4 c002f2a8 c53bfed4 c53bfec8
fec0: bf376cbc bf075d28 c53bfefc c53bfed8 bf18026c bf376cb8 c512c120 49446d84
fee0: 49446d84 00000000 c001fea4 c53be000 c53bff2c c41ff920 00000000 41ae766c
ff00: 00000230 c001fea4 c53be000 00000000 c53bff2c c53bff20 bf37bd54 bf069954
ff20: c53bff4c c53bff30 c008e3a0 bf37bd30 c41ff920 41ae766c 0000000f 0000000f
ff40: c53bff7c c53bff50 c008e684 c008e334 00000000 c53bff60 c004ed74 c0139c8c
ff60: c53bffa4 c41ff920 41ae766c 00000230 c53bffa4 c53bff80 c008e6ec c008e3c8
ff80: c53bffa4 00000001 00268548 41ae766c 00000002 00000036 00000000 c53bffa8
ffa0: c001fd00 c008e6b8 00268548 41ae766c 0000000f 00000230 41ae766c 00000230
ffc0: 00268548 41ae766c 00000002 00000036 00000000 bee4c664 00000001 40a361a4
ffe0: 00000000 49446da8 400af404 40952d9c 20000010 0000000f 1affff95 e5d40053
Backtrace:
[<bf075cc0>] (vIO32Write1BMsk+0x0/0x44 [ioctl_reg_func]) from [<bf0b974c>] (vDrvOutputStageInit+0x48/0x474 [ioctl_reg_func])
r7:00000028 r6:00000000 r5:bf59eed0 r4:bf56eccc
[<bf0b9704>] (vDrvOutputStageInit+0x0/0x474 [ioctl_reg_func]) from [<bf0baca8>] (vDrvDisplayInit+0x7c/0x170 [ioctl_reg_func])
[<bf0bac2c>] (vDrvDisplayInit+0x0/0x170 [ioctl_reg_func]) from [<bf09cc94>] (vApiHwInit+0x18/0x110 [ioctl_reg_func])
r5:00000000 r4:bf5a1a6c
[<bf09cc7c>] (vApiHwInit+0x0/0x110 [ioctl_reg_func]) from [<bf0eb294>] (VdoMLInit+0x64/0x110 [ioctl_reg_func])
[<bf0eb230>] (VdoMLInit+0x0/0x110 [ioctl_reg_func]) from [<bf04f2ac>] (MW_TvdInit+0x4c/0x238 [ioctl_reg_func])
r5:00000000 r4:00000000
[<bf04f260>] (MW_TvdInit+0x0/0x238 [ioctl_reg_func]) from [<bf057c90>] (x_drv_init+0x29c/0x8b4 [ioctl_reg_func])
[<bf0579f4>] (x_drv_init+0x0/0x8b4 [ioctl_reg_func]) from [<bf06a098>] (rm_dev_ioctl+0x750/0x4a98 [ioctl_reg_func])
r7:00000028 r6:bf58f718 r5:00410002 r4:bf58f718
[<bf069948>] (rm_dev_ioctl+0x0/0x4a98 [ioctl_reg_func]) from [<bf37bd54>] (adapt_dev_ioctl+0x30/0x3c [ioctl_reg_func])
[<bf37bd24>] (adapt_dev_ioctl+0x0/0x3c [ioctl_reg_func]) from [<c008e3a0>] (vfs_ioctl+0x78/0x94)
[<c008e328>] (vfs_ioctl+0x0/0x94) from [<c008e684>] (do_vfs_ioctl+0x2c8/0x2f0)
r7:0000000f r6:0000000f r5:41ae766c r4:c41ff920
[<c008e3bc>] (do_vfs_ioctl+0x0/0x2f0) from [<c008e6ec>] (sys_ioctl+0x40/0x64)
r6:00000230 r5:41ae766c r4:c41ff920
[<c008e6ac>] (sys_ioctl+0x0/0x64) from [<c001fd00>] (ret_fast_syscall+0x0/0x2c)
r7:00000036 r6:00000002 r5:41ae766c r4:00268548
Code: e1a07187 eb0c03f5 e5943000 e0056006 (e1c35715)
---[ end trace 1cd4b3b72c0f911a ]---
MTAL: Init IR Type: 0x1
input thread pid is 294 tid is 297
original scheduler policy 0
scheduler nice -10
original child scheduler policy 0 prio 0
new child scheduler policy 2 prio 99
Start to wait IR event... 到这步停了
|